EDITORS COMMENTS
This evocative photograph captures the scenic beauty and vibrant energy of Philippeville, now known as Skikda, in Algeria during the 1930s. The image showcases a bustling street lined with European-style buildings, their facades adorned with intricate architectural details and balconies filled with people watching the world go by. The cobblestone road is filled with the sounds of clattering horse-drawn carts and the rumble of passing cars, symbolizing the intersection of traditional and modern modes of transportation. In the background, the clear blue waters of the bay shimmer in the sunlight, dotted with fishing boats and ships anchored at the coast. The minaret of a mosque can be seen in the distance, a testament to the rich cultural diversity of this North African town. The photograph, taken circa 1932, offers a glimpse into a bygone era, inviting us to imagine the sights, sounds, and smells of this bustling Mediterranean town during the 1930s.
